زیر سیستم مالتی مدیای اینترنتی: IMS

comments5 نظر views بازدید
اشتراک گذاری/نشانه گذاری

IMS‌ زیر سیستمی از شبکه های نسل آینده (NGN) است که امکان فراهم آوردن سرویس‌های چندرسانه‌ای (مالتی مدیا) اینترنتی مانند ویدئو کنفرانس و VoIP (ویپ) را از طریق شبکه‌های بیسم بی‌سیم (مانند ۳G و GPRS و وایمکس) و یا کابلی (مانند ADSL) فراهم می‌آورد.

پیدایش IMS

رویکرد کنونی در مخابرات نوین حرکت به سوی استفاده از پروتکل IP به عنوان پروتکلی برای همگرایی شبکه‌های گوناگون است که همین رویکرد هدف اصلی ابداع این پروتکل نیز میباشد. گسترش استفاده از پروتکل IP در شبکه‌های بیسیم سلولی باعث گردید که کمیته ۳GPP که ترکیبی از کمیته‌های مخابراتی مانند کمیته‌های ETSI از اروپا، ARIB از ژاپن و … است، در ویرایش ۵ از شبکه نسل سوم UMTS زیرسیستم IMS را معرفی کند. مزایای استفاده از زیر سیستم مالتی مدیای IMS باعث گردیده است که استفاده از این زیرسیستم در شبکه‌های باند وسیع ثابت مانند ADSL نیز مورد توجه قرار گیرد. در حال حاضر IMS میتواند با وایمکس و وای فای و در کل هر نوع شبکه دسترسی باند وسیع کار کند.

رابطه IMS و شبکه نسل آینده (NGN)

در سال ۲۰۰۲ سازمان ITU-T گروه تمرکز بر شبکه‌های نسل آینده (NGN-FG) را ایجاد کرد که وظیفه مطالعه و پیشبرد استفاده از IMS در شبکه های بیسم و کابلی نسل آینده را بر عهده دارد. در اروپا، ETSI کمیته فنی سرویس‌های همگرای مخابراتی و اینترنت و پروتکل‌ها برای شبکه‌های پیشرفته (TISPAN) را در سال ۲۰۰۱ برای استاندارد کردن استفاده از IMS در شبکه‌های سیمی به وجود آورد. این کمیته‌ها نحوه تطبیق IMS بر شبکه‌‌های کابلی را در قالب شبکه‌های نسل آینده و یا اصطلاحا NGN معرفی کرده‌اند. بنابراین برای درک ساختار NGN‌ مطالعه زیرسیستم IMS‌ مفید می‌باشد.

معرفی زیر سیستم مالتی مدیا (IMS)

IMS زیرسیستمی است که به شبکه‌های سلولی اضافه شده است تا ایجاد، کنترل و مدیریت نشست‌های چندرسانه‌ای سوئیچ پاکتی را ممکن سازد. IMS‌ برای انجام این کار از پروتکل SIP استفاده می‌کند. همچنین IMS تعامل با شبکه‌های قدیمی مانند PSTN‌ را نیز مد نظر دارد. برای تعامل با این شبکه‌ها از دروازه‌های رسانه (Media Gateway که در بازار VoIP Gateway هم نامیده میشود) استفاده میکند که مسئول نگاشت ارتباطات سوئیچ پاکتی بر روی کانال‌های سوئیچ مداری هستند.

در مجموع IMS دارای قابلیت پشتیبانی از موارد زیر است:

  • پشتیبانی از ایجاد نشست‌های چندرسانه‌ای IP (مالتی مدیا). مثلا IMS میتواند تماسهای VoIP و یا ویدئو کنفرانس برقرار کند.
  • پشتیبانی از مکانیسم‌های مذاکره و کنترل QoS
  • پشتیبانی از تعامل با شبکه‌های IP و شبکه‌های سوئیچ مداری
  • پشتیبانی از رومینگ
  • پشتیبانی از کنترل موثر اپراتور بر سرویس‌هایی که به کاربر ارائه می‌گردند.
  • پشتیبانی از ایجاد سریع و ساده سرویس‌های مختلف بدون نیاز به استاندارد‌سازی
  • پشتیبانی از روش‌های دسترسی مختلف (از نسخه ۶ شبکه UMTS‌ به بعد در نظر گرفته شده است)

پروتکل های IMS

در IMS‌ از پروتکل‌های مختلفی استفاده می‌شود که مهمترین آن‌ها عبارتند از:

  • پروتکل SIP برای کنترل نشست‌های چندرسانه‌ای
  • پروتکل Diameter برای تأمین شناسایی، صدور مجوز و حسابرسی (AAA). این پروتکل تکامل یافته پروتکل Radius محسوب می‌شود.
  • پروتکل ‍COPS برای انتقال سیاست‌ها بین نقاطع تصمیم‌گیری سیاست (PDP) و نقاطع اعمال سیاست (PEP)
  • H.248 برای انتقال سیگنالینگ بین کنترل کننده دروازه رسانه (MGC) و دروازه رسانه (MGW).
  • RTP و RTCP برای انتقال ترافیک بلادرنگ

ساختار شبکه IMS

شکل زیر ساختار IMS را نشان می‌دهد. اجزاء نشان داده شده در شکل اجزاء منطقی و نه لزوماً فیزیکی هستند. معمولاً سازندگان چندین واحد کارکردی را در یک واحد فیزیکی پیاده‌سازی می‌کنند. توجه کنید اکثر واحدهای IMS در شبکه نسل آینده NGN در لایه سرویس قرار گرفته‌اند. با این وجود دروازه رسانه (MGW) در شبکه NGN جزء لایه انتقال محسوب می‌گردد. در ادامه به بررسی اجزاء IMS می‌‌پردازیم.

clip_image002[13]

پایگاه‌های داده IMS:

در IMS دو نوع پایگاه داده برای کاربر در نظر گرفته شده است:

  1. HSS: پایگاه داده مرکزی برای اطلاعات کاربران است. HSS‌ در واقع تکامل یافته HLR در شبکه GSM‌ محسوب می‌گردد. اطلاعات مورد نیاز برای تأمین امنیت کاربران (شناسایی و رمزنگاری)، اطلاعات موقعیت کاربران و پروفایل کاربران (سرویس‌های که کاربر مشترک آن‌ها است) می‌باشد. ممکن است شبکه شامل یک یا چند HSS باشد. انتخاب تعداد HSS ها به سیاست‌های اپراتور و تعداد کاربران بستگی دارد.
  2. SLF: در صورتی که در شبکه از چندین HSS استفاده شود، لازم است HSS‌ سرویس دهنده به هر کاربر مشخص باشد. نگاشت HSS‌ به کاربران در SLF ذخیره می‌شود. اگر گره‌ای در IMS به اطلاعات کاربران نیاز داشته باشد، آدرس کاربر را به SLF‌ ارسال می‌کند و آدرس HSS‌ سرویس دهنده را دریافت می‌کند. در شبکه‌هایی که تنها یک HSS‌ دارند، به استفاده از SLF نیازی نیست.

کنترل‌ کننده‌های تماس/نشست در IMS:

این گره‌ها در واقع سرورهای SIP هستند و از واحدهای اصلی IMS محسوب می‌گردند. سه نوع کنترل کننده تماس/نشست وجود دارد:

  • P-CSCF: اولین نقطه تماس IMS‌ با کاربر محسوب می‌شود. با این معنا که تمام درخواست‌ها کاربر ابتدا به دست این واحد می‌رسد. این واحد وظایف امنیتی مانند شناسایی کاربر از طریق با HSS، ایجاد تونل امن IPsec و تأیید اعتبار پیام‌های دریافتی از کاربر را برعهده دارد. ممکن است این واحد پیام‌های SIP‌ دریافت شده از کاربر را فشرده‌سازی نیز کند. اعمال سیاست‌های شبکه از طریق ارتباط این گره و PDP ممکن است.
  • I-CSCF: یک سرور SIP است که در مرز شبکه با شبکه‌های خارجی پیاده‌سازی می‌شود. زمانی که قرار است یک ارتباط بین دو کاربر که در دو دامنه مختلف قرار دارند، برقرار شود، سرور SIP واقع در شبکه خارجی با I-CSCF تماس می‌گیرد. I-CSCF علاوه بر وظایف معمول سرورهای SIP، با HSS و SLF‌ ارتباط برقرار می‌کند تا آدرس سرور SIP که به کاربر سرویس می‌دهد را بدست آورد و به این ترتیب پیام‌های SIP‌ به صورت مناسب مسیریابی خواهند شد. همچنین این سرور وظیفه پنهان‌سازی توپولوژی شبکه از دید شبکه‌های خارجی را نیز برعهده دارد. معمولاً هر شبکه دارای چندین I-CSCF است.
  • S-CSCF: سرور SIP است که وظیفه کنترل نشست را برعهده دارد. تمام پیام‌های SIP کاربر از S-CSCF عبور می‌کنند و این واحد تشخیص می‌دهد که در چه موارد باید پیام‌ها به سرورهای کاربرد ارسال شوند. مسیریابی یکی از وظایف مهم این واحد است. زمانی که کاربر به جای URI از یک شماره تلفن برای ارتباط استفاده می‌کند، S-CSCF وظیفه ترجمه شماره تلفن را برعهده دارد.

سرورهای کاربرد (Application Servers):

سرویس‌ها را در بردارد و اجرا می‌کند. AS می‌تواند به عنوان یک عامل کاربر (SIP UA)، به صورت یک پروکسی و یا به صورت دو عامل کاربر عمل کند. سه نوع AS وجود دارد:

  • SIP AS: سرور کاربرد اصلی SIP است و سرویس‌های چندرسانه‌ای روی آن پیاده‌سازی می‌شود.
  • OSA-SCS: ارتباط با سرور کاربرد OSA‌ را فراهم می‌آورد. این گره از طرف S-CSCF به عنوان یک سرور کاربرد و از طرف رابطی بین سرور کاربرد OSA و OSA API دیده می‌شود.
  • IM-SSF: برای استفاده دوباره از CAMEL در IMS است.

Media Resource Function و یا MRF:

به شبکه خانگی اجازه پخش اعلام‌ها، میکس کردن جریان‌های رسانه (مثلاً در ارتباط کنفرانسی)، تبدیل Codecها و بدست آوردن آمار و آنالیز جریان‌های داده، می‌دهد. MRF به دو واحد زیر تقسیم می‌شود:

  • MRCF: مانند یک عامل کاربر SIP با S-CSCF‌ ارتباط دارد و MRFP را کنترل می‌کند.
  • MRFP تمامی وظایف نظیر میکس کردن جریان‌ها و تبدیل Codec ها در این بخش انجام می‌شود.

Border Gateway Control Function و یا BGCF:

یک سرور SIP است که مسیریابی بر اساس شماره‌های تلفن را نیز در بر دارد. BGCF‌ تنها در مواقعی استفاده می‌شود که لازم باشد تماسی بین کاربر IMS و کاربری در شبکه PSTN برقرار شود. دو وظیفه اصلی این واحد عبارتند از:

  • انتخاب شبکه‌ مناسبی که تعامل با شبکه‌ PSTN در آن روی خواهد داد
  • انتخاب دروازه مناسب برای ارتباط با PSTN در صورتی که تعامل با PSTN در شبکه حاوی PGCF روی دهد.

دروازه PSTN و شبکه‌های سوئیچ مداری:

به سه قسمت زیر تقسیم می‌شود:

  • SGW: وظیفه انتقال سیگنالینگ بین شبکه IMS و شبکه PSTN‌ را برعهده دارد. SGW پروتکل‌ ISUP و یا BICC را به جای انتقال بر روی MTP بر روی SCTP/IP منتقل می‌کند.
  • MGWC: قسمت اصلی دروازه شبکه PSTN است و وظیفه تبدیل پروتکل SIP به پروتکل‌ ISUP و یا BICC را برعهده دارد. این واحد منابع دروازه رسانه را نیز کنترل می‌کند. ارتباط MGWC و MGW با پروتکل H.248 برقرار می‌شود.
  • MGW: دروازه رسانه ترافیک IMS‌ را که به صورت سوئیچ پاکتی بر روی RTP دریافت کرده است، بر روی شیارهای زمانی TDM ارسال می‌کند. ممکن است این واحد عمل تبدیل کدینگ نیز در صورتی که ترمینال‌ها کدینگ‌های یکدیگر را پشتیبانی نکنند، انجام دهد.

5 پاسخ به “زیر سیستم مالتی مدیای اینترنتی: IMS”

  1. رسول گفت:

    با عرض سلام
    لطفا درموردپروتکل bicc وsigtran توضیح دهید

  2. ستاره گفت:

    میشه منبع این مقاله مربوط به IMS را برای من میل کنید

  3. سحر گفت:

    سلام،میشه منبع مقاله مربوط به IMS را برای من میل کنید

  4. سحر گفت:

    یه زحمت دارم یه مقاله فارسی زبان با منبع با موضوع شبکه های مالتی مدیا به ایمیل من بفرستید
    ممنون،خیلی لطف میکنید

  5. سحر گفت:

    سلام لطف میکنید منبع این مقاله رو برای ایمیل من بفرستید ممنون میشم ازتون

پاسخ دهید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*